OKeh 8487 (10-in. double-faced)

The following matrix(es) were released with this catalog number:

CompanyMatrix No.Take NumberDateTitle/Artist 
OKeh W81106 A 6/23/1927 Lignum vitae / Adolphe Thensted's Mentor Boys ; Sam Manning
OKeh W81107 B 6/23/1927 Emily / Adolphe Thensted's Mentor Boys ; Sam Manning

Primary Performers:

Sam Manning (vocalist)
Adolphe Thensted's Mentor Boys (Musical group)
